Property Line Clearing in Atlanta, GA
Property line clearing services involve removing trees, shrubs, and other vegetation along the boundaries of a property to establish clear, defined lines. This process is commonly requested for projects such as installing new fencing, expanding yard space, or preventing encroachments from neighboring growth. Homeowners often seek this service to improve privacy, enhance curb appeal, or prepare for landscaping and construction projects, ensuring that property boundaries are visible and unobstructed.
Before requesting property line clearing, property owners typically want to understand the scope of the work, including the types of vegetation that will be removed and how the clearing may affect existing trees or landscape features. It is also helpful to have clear property boundary information and any local regulations or restrictions related to vegetation removal. Proper planning ensures the project meets both aesthetic and practical goals while respecting property lines and neighboring properties.

Property Line Clearing Questions
What is property line clearing? Property line cl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and overgrowth along property boundaries to establish clear and defined lines.
Why should property lines be cleared? Clearing property lines helps prevent disputes, improves privacy, and prepares the land for development or landscaping projects.
What types of projects benefit from line clearing? Projects such as fencing, landscaping, building additions, or simply defining property boundaries often require line clearing services.
What should property owners consider before clearing? It’s important to identify property boundaries accurately and consider local regulations regarding tree removal and land clearing.
